WebDec 16, 2024 · The RDW blood test is a clinical procedure to measure the volume and size variations in the red blood cells. If there is a variance in size or volume from the usual clinical range, further examination needs to happen. Depending on the doctor, you may undergo a CBC blood test. WebJul 7, 2024 · A high RDW means you have both very small and very large red blood cells. You may also have a “normal” RDW. A normal RDW range is 12.2%–16.1% for women and 11.8%–14.5% for men. WebThe RDW test is commonly used to help diagnose anemia, a condition in which your red blood cells can't carry enough oxygen to the rest of your body.
